comparemela.com
Home
Motorcycle Dealers In 61281
Top Locations Tagged with Motorcycle Dealers In 61281
Motorcycle Dealers In 61281 in United States - 61281/Motorcycle-dealers near Mercer
1). Cycle Art Sherrard Il United States
vimarsana © 2020. All Rights Reserved.